2 Samuel 16:12

WEB

12It may be that the LORD will look on the wrong done to me, and that the LORD will repay me good for the cursing of me today.”

KJV

12It may be that the LORD will look on mine affliction, and that the LORD will requite me good for his cursing this day.

BSB

12Perhaps the LORD will see my affliction and repay me with good for the cursing I receive today.”

FBV

12Perhaps the Lord will see how I'm suffering and will pay me back with good for his curses today.”
